Similarities Between Star Wars And Star Trek
While Star Wars and Star Trek are similar in the ways that they are both set in galaxies different from earth, they differ in the ways that they are based off of separate events through space. Star Wars focuses on a war while Star Trek focuses on trips to different planets fighting space aliens. The two franchises share many similarities. Both franchises show different species coexisting with each other on multiple planets. Star wars focuses on the harsher side of co-existing with aliens, for example, bounty hunters who hunt and kill any alien for profit, while the Star Trek personalities just happen to bump into wrong aliens and have to fight them to defend themselves.
